Web2 Sep 2024 · Here are some of the best places to visit: 1. Staubbach Falls in Lauterbrunnen Switzerland. Staubbach Falls is a waterfall located west above the village. The waterfall drops at the height of 297 meters from a hanging cliff and is called the largest waterfall of Switzerland besides the Seerenbachfälle at the Walensee (Lake Walen). Web9 Jul 2024 · Trummelbach Falls in Lauterbrunnen Valley. Trummelbach falls is comprised of 10 waterfalls, fed by glaciers, that have cut through the rocky mountain-side to form huge underground channels and torrents. Basically a bunch of waterfalls INSIDE the mountain. Web5 Oct 2024 · Try Completing the Via Ferrata to Murren. One of the most interesting ways to explore the terrain around Lauterbrunnen is through treks or activities called Via Ferrata. These activities involve hiking or crossing rock terrains with the help of steel cables and narrow steel bridges suspended to the side of cliffs.
